Output 90f71784b0292fcd36941e16c9953db0f4fc5fbb33d12f406b8356dd75548581:0

value
4417363856
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b6483fd89c3b56b5e592e68f8cea1e523806efb2 OP_EQUALVERIFY OP_CHECKSIG
address
DMkv59XXT5zw6WM2ATnRCH4vwoM8G7cvqE
transaction
90f71784b0292fcd36941e16c9953db0f4fc5fbb33d12f406b8356dd75548581